Corn still up....
So I have a dilema... I typically hunt on the tree line of a large field. In front of me is about 40 acres of corn, then a marsh. Behind me is a woods. However, we only have permission for about 50ft of the woods because the poperty line cuts through. The deer typically bed in the marsh and travel between the woods throughout the day. Its been a great stand for a number of years. However, thanks to good amount of rain the last week of October, the corn is still standing between me and the marsh. There is good chance that it will still be standing come this weekends Wisconsin opener. Any suggestions our thoughts if that corn is still standing. My shooting windows just got very very small.....
